Q. A block-spring system oscillates with amplitude of 3.70 cm. The spring constant is 250 N/m and the mass of the block is 0.500 kg.
(a) Determine the mechanical energy of the system.
(b) Establish the maximum speed of the block.
(c) Determine the maximum acceleration.
